Frequently Asked Questions about Prayer Times in Benin

Fajr prayer time in Benin, Benin begins at dawn and ends just before sunrise. Using the Umm Al-Qura University, Makkah calculation method, the Fajr time is determined by the angle of the sun below the horizon. This is the first prayer of the day and consists of 2 rakats.
Dhuhr (Zuhr) prayer in Benin begins after the sun passes its zenith (highest point). In Africa/Porto-Novo timezone, this occurs around midday. It is the second prayer of the day and consists of 4 rakats.
Asr prayer time in Benin begins when the shadow of an object equals its length. This is the third prayer of the day and consists of 4 rakats.
Maghrib prayer in Benin starts immediately after sunset. It is the fourth daily prayer and consists of 3 rakats.
Isha prayer time in Benin begins after the red twilight disappears from the sky. It is the fifth and final obligatory prayer.
